OBLIGATIONS OF THE PERSON IN CHARGE OF THE DEVICE
The owner of the appliance and/or any person responsible for
safety are required to:
• Ensure that all users of the appliance are adequately trained
as regards current occupational health and safety regulations.
• Ensure that all users of the appliance have read this user
manual in its entirety and have understood all of it, in particular
the sections on safety standards.
• Periodically check that all personnel always operate in
compliance with safety standards.
• Periodically check that all the safety signs axed to the
device (data plate, stickers bearing danger symbols, etc.)
are clearly legible and not damaged, overwritten, removed or
obscured by other objects.

Personnel authorised to use the appliance must:
• Operate in accordance with current occupational health and
safety regulations.
• Read this user manual carefully, paying particular attention to
the sections on safety standards.
• Sign a document in which they declare that they have read
and understood this manual, and that they undertake to
follow all the instructions contained therein.
• Wear suitable personal protective equipment (see chapter
1.1) before using the appliance.
• Use the appliance only as explained in this manual; improper
use increases the risk of accidental personal injury and/or
property damage.
• Take appropriate precautions and always secure the device
during periods when the workstation is not manned (such as
during breaks or at the end of the shift).
